THE WEATHER.
TO-DAY'S BAROMETER
MAGNETIC OBSERVATORY. GHRISTCHILKC'V. Meteorological observations taken at 9.39 a.m. on Tuesday, July 24: Barometer —29.625, rising. . Mi'immn temperature (luring preceding twenty-four hours—49.3. Minimum temperature during preceding twenty-four hours—3«.9. Temperature at 9.30 a.m.—Dry bulb 43.4. wet bulb 41.0. Humidity per cent —£2. Maximum' temperature in sun—Bl. Minimum thermometer on grase—2B,7. Cloud—Nil. Wind—W.. very light. ■Rainfall—Nil. Rainfall to dato this year—t6.4s7in. liainfall to date last year—l7.3slin. DOMINION FORECAST. The Government M'eteoro'sist reports: Wind, moderate to strong southerly and veering by south to west. Expect changeable and showery weather. The night will probably be very cold. Barometer unsteady.
